Dietz-Kapelle

The Dietz-Kapelle is a chapel located in Reuth b.Erbendorf, Germany.

History

The exact date of construction is not known, but it is believed to have been built in the 19th century.

Architecture

The chapel is an example of Germanic Revival architecture, with a simple and functional design. The building's style is characterized by its use of stone and brick, with a steeply pitched roof and a single nave.

Location

The Dietz-Kapelle is situated on Mühlenweg in Reuth b.Erbendorf, Germany.
